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: 1. Newly diagnosed case of hypothyroidism 2. Patients age should be above 20 years and below 60 years 3. Based on thyroid profile elevated level of serum TSH level or low level of serum T3 & T4. However the cases of which T3 & T4 levels are within normal range and TSH level is high will also included. 4. Patients those have given written consent to participate in the study.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: 1. All complecated cases of hypothyroidism goiter, myxoedema, severe mental illness, thyroid cancer etc and other associate with other endocrine disorders. 2. Patients having chronic systemic illness. 3. Congenital hypothyroidism. 4. Pregnant women and lactating mother. 5. Patients having undergone thyroid surgery
